The 1981 Nicholls State Colonels football team represented Nicholls State University in the 1981 NCAA Division I-AA football season. The Colonels were led by first-year head coach Sonny Jackson. They played their home games at John L. Guidry Stadium and were an NCAA Division I-AA Independent. They finished the season 5–5–1.
Previous season
The Colonels finished the season 2–9 as an NCAA Division I-AA Independent.
Schedule
Date | Time | Opponent# | Rank# | Site | TV | Result | |||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
September 12 | Delta State (Division II) |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A | W 34–10 | ||||||
September 19 | McNeese State |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A | L 9–59 | ||||||
September 26 | at Troy State (Division II) | Veterans Memorial Stadium • Troy, AL | L 23–26 | ||||||
October 3 | U.S. Merchant Marine (Division III) |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A | W 45–3 | ||||||
October 10 | Southern |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A | W 56–14 | ||||||
October 17 | Texas Southern |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A | W 31–27 | ||||||
October 24 | at Tennessee State | Hale Stadium • Nashville, TN | L 11–49 | ||||||
October 31 | at Northeast Louisiana | Malone Stadium • Monroe, LA | L 18–55 | ||||||
November 7 | Northwestern State |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A (NSU Challenge) | L 17–31 | ||||||
November 14 | at Southeastern Louisiana | Strawberry Stadium • Hammond, LA (River Bell Classic) | W 29–17 | ||||||
November 21 | Southwest Missouri State (Division II) | John L. Guidry Stadium • Thibodaux, LA | T 20–20 | ||||||
